This is the Long March to Freedom, part of a bigger development of over 500 life-size bronze icons of South Africa's struggle for freedom. All the figures together represent a time-line of South Africa's 350-year journey to democracy. It is the largest outdoor sculptural display of individuals in the world and uses public art to celebrate the country's heritage while giving visitors the opportunity to learn about South African history in an unusual and entertaining way. 1. Robben Island is known for being the place former South African president Nelson Mandela was jailed for 18 of his 27 years, but the Island was the home of prisoners from outside South Africa, notably Namibia.

There are plenty of free-roaming African Penguins At Robben Island.

Situated in South Africa's oldest working harbor, the 123 hectares (300 acres) area has been developed for mixed-use, with both residential and commercial real estate. The Waterfront attracts more than 23 million visitors a year.
